NATURE AND SCOPE

The Digital Team is a new function within the UK's largest electricity district network operator. Our remit is wide ranging, covering all teams and departments within a business which compromises customer satisfaction, regulatory restrictions and KPIs, asset management, field operations, HR, Finance and much more.

We are NOT a traditional Digital team. Most people see us as an internal consulting team or a start-up. We are close knit, supportive, dynamic and work in agile ways. We are big on feedback and motivated to constantly improve and do better. Our mandate is to be a supportive, challenging friend to the business, thinking creatively, to bring new approaches, methods and ways of thinking to some of the industry's biggest problems.

We are encouraged to innovate, with the only prescriptions being that we can 1) Measure the scale of an improvement should the recommended actions be undertaken and 2) Achieve business support for implementing those recommendations. You will help us realise this.

We are accountable in supporting the business in achieving its vision of becoming an 'employer of choice', 'a respected corporate citizen', 'sustainably cost efficient' and 'enabling the Net Zero transition for all'.

Within the utilities sector we are a leader winning a trio of awards at the industry's Utility Week Awards including; the Diversity Award, the Staff Development Award and the Digital Transformation Award.

More specifically the Digital Business Partnering Team acts as the conduit and critical friend representing both Information Systems and the business teams we work with. It's our role to help business leaders and their teams to think strategically about their digital and technology needs, to connect the dots between new, planned and live projects and lead overall visibility of changes being suggested or made to our digital and technology landscape.

As a new team we have the opportunity to shape what Digital Business Partnering means at UKPN, create the tools and ways of working that we need to be successful and drive collaborative working across functions.
